Diffusion, being a slow process will take a lot of time to circulate oxygen to all the body cells. Hence, diffusion is insufficient to meet the oxygen requirements of multicellular organisms like humans.so this is the answer

here is the answer of your question ...multicellular organisms have Complex body designs and a large body shape.t
hence they need more oxygen to carryout cellular respiration.unlike unicellular organisms, multicellular organisms do not have all the cells of the body in direct contact with the environment .hence diffusion cannot meet the energy requirements of our body needs.
